What Defines a Cafe Racer Style Electric Bicycle?
Cafe racer e-bikes feature distinctive elements: bullet-shaped battery packs integrated into triangular frames, brown leather saddles, and drop-style handlebars. The design philosophy emphasizes reduced weight (typically 25-35 kg) through aluminum alloy construction while maintaining torque outputs of 60-85 Nm for urban acceleration. Historical inspiration comes from 1960s British motorcycle culture adapted for pedal-assisted commuting.
Modern iterations often incorporate LED matrix headlights that consume less than 10% of battery capacity per hour. Frame geometry prioritizes a low center of gravity, with wheelbases measuring 1100-1200mm for agile cornering. Many models use 6061-T6 aluminum frames with butted tubing to reduce weight without compromising structural integrity. The signature “crouched” riding position reduces wind resistance by 18-22% compared to upright commuter bikes.
How Do Cafe Racer E-Bikes Compare to Traditional Models?
Compared to commuter e-bikes, cafe racer versions offer 15-25% higher speed caps (up to 45 km/h in performance models) with narrower tires (27.5″ x 2.1″) for responsive handling. Their mid-mounted motors position weight centrally for improved balance during cornering. Battery placement mimics vintage gas tanks while providing 48V 14Ah capacity – sufficient for 2-hour continuous rides at 32 km/h assist levels.

Which Components Impact Performance Most?
Critical components include:
- Mid-drive motors (e.g., Bafang M620) offering 95% energy efficiency
- LG/Samsung 21700 battery cells with 1500+ charge cycles
- Hydraulic disc brakes (180mm rotors minimum)
- 8-speed Shimano Altus derailleurs for hill climbing
- LED lighting systems drawing ≤5W power
What Are the Hidden Costs of Ownership?
Beyond purchase price, expect:
- Battery replacements every 4-5 years ($400-$700)
- Annual drivetrain maintenance ($120-$200)
- Specialized tire costs ($80-$150 pair)
- Insurance premiums (~$15/month for $3,000 coverage)
- Storage solutions (vertical stands $45-$120)
How to Customize on a Budget?
Cost-effective upgrades include:
- Vinyl tank decals ($15-$30)
- Bar-end mirrors ($25-$60 pair)
- Aftermarket grips ($20-$50)
- DIY leather saddle restoration kits ($35)
- Spoke card customization through print-on-demand services
